Margaret McNamara Memorial Fund; SPSSI Awards; American Statistical Association Scholarships for Graduate Students; James Madison Memorial …The James Madison Memorial Building is one of three United States Capitol Complex buildings that house the Library of Congress. The building was constructed from 1971 to 1976, and serves as the official memorial to United States Founding Father and president James Madison. Kompleks pemakaman Buddhist dan Kristen bernuansa Resort serta bertaraf …The James Madison Memorial Fellowship Foundation was established by Congress in 1986 for the purpose of improving teaching about the United States Constitution in secondary schools. The Foundation is an independent agency of the Executive Branch of the federal government.
